Favre Leuba Unveils Green Dial Sea Sky Revival Chronograph

December 04

Favre Leuba introduces a new chronograph to its Sea Sky Revival series, drawing inspiration from its rich history while incorporating elements of 1980s aesthetics. This particular model stands out with its vivid green dial, a fresh addition following previous releases in more subdued tones like black, brown, and blue. The watch’s design harmoniously blends vintage charm with contemporary appeal, ensuring both a nostalgic feel and a modern edge.

A key feature of this new timepiece is its vibrant green sunburst dial, which immediately captures attention with its striking depth and dynamic energy. Setting it apart from earlier iterations, this chronograph boasts black subdials, creating a distinct and captivating contrast against the bright green backdrop. The arrow-shaped minute hand and elongated hour markers are coated with green Super-LumiNova, guaranteeing excellent readability even in dim lighting conditions. Additionally, the presence of tachymeter and telemeter scales on the flange pays homage to traditional chronographs, emphasizing their historical role as precise measuring instruments.

Encased in a robust 40mm stainless-steel housing, the watch has a height of 15.23mm and is fitted with a bidirectional ceramic bezel. Powering this exquisite timepiece is the self-winding caliber FLC01, a movement collaboratively developed with La Joux-Perret. This sophisticated mechanism offers a substantial 60-hour power reserve and features column-wheel control, which ensures precise and smooth chronograph operation. The intricate finishing details of the movement, such as blued screws, Geneva Stripes, perlage decoration, and a personalized 4N-gold-plated skeleton rotor, are beautifully showcased through the transparent sapphire case back. This blend of classic horological craftsmanship and modern design is available for purchase at $4,950.

This latest offering from Favre Leuba demonstrates a commitment to innovation while honoring its historical legacy. The integration of a bold color scheme and meticulous mechanical details makes this chronograph a compelling choice for enthusiasts seeking a watch that combines vintage aesthetics with high-performance functionality. The thoughtful design elements, from the contrasting dial to the visible movement, highlight the brand's dedication to both form and function, positioning this new model as a notable addition to the contemporary watch market.
